Subject: Visitors after 22:00 — quick reminder

Hi night crew,

Couple of late visitors expected this week for the Larkspur project, so heads up. Anyone showing up after 22:00 needs to sign the paper log (the tablet's still flaky) and wait in the lobby until their host comes down. No exceptions, even if they "know the way." If the host doesn't answer after two tries, politely send them off.

To let hosts in through the side door, use the pass below.

Cheers,
Marisol, Front Desk

staff pass of haweg-bafop = bdg-G-69

Q3 Planning Note — Budget Request

Branch managers: Halvern Instruments is requesting an additional allocation of 240,000 for the Lorris depot refit, split across tooling, staff training, and freight contingency. We have reviewed each line twice with regional finance and trimmed discretionary travel to offset roughly a third of the ask. Please review before Thursday's call. The strategic rationale is summarized in the confidential note below.

board note of kageg-bahof: The renewal with Holwynax Holdings closes at $2 million a year, 5 percent below the last contract. Project Ulaath slips by two quarters because of the supplier delay.

Ticket: Greenhouse bay 3 humidity drift traced to the Pottergren controller reading the staging calibration service instead of prod. Wrong env file shipped in last rollout. Offsets compounded ~0.4% per hour. Fix: repoint calibration endpoint, restart Pottergren agents, verify drift flattens within two cycles. Blocking item: the prod calibration service rejects unauthenticated agents, so the env file needs the calibration API secret added on the following line:

sealed setting: ARCHIVE_KEY3=8d0